Why study in Canada?

  • High-Quality Education: Canada is renowned for its world-class education system, which offers high-quality programs and degrees recognised globally.
  • Multicultural Environment: Canada is a welcoming and diverse country that celebrates different cultures and offers international students a safe and friendly environment.
  • Affordable Education: The cost of education in Canada is relatively lower compared to other English-speaking countries like the US and the UK.
  • Employment Opportunities: Canadian universities and colleges offer co-op programs, internships, and work-study options that help students gain practical experience and improve their chances of finding employment after graduation.
  • Research Opportunities: Canada is a research-oriented country that invests heavily in research and innovation. Studying in Canada offers excellent research opportunities for students to work with leading academics and researchers.
  • Quality of Life: Canada is consistently ranked as one of the best countries in the world for its high quality of life, health care, and social benefits.
  • Post-Graduation Work Permits: International students who complete their studies in Canada can apply for a post-graduation work permit, which allows them to work in Canada for up to three years after graduation.

IELTS Band Score for Studying in Canada

International students must prove their English proficiency by achieving a specific IELTS band score to study in Canada. The IELTS band score is between 0 and 9, reflecting the individual's ability to communicate in English. This score is obtained by averaging the scores from the various components of the IELTS exam. For example, if individuals score 7 on the reading component, 8 on the listening component, 7 on the writing component, and 7.5 on the speaking component, their overall IELTS band score would be 7.375, rounded to 7.5.

In Canada, most universities and colleges require a minimum IELTS band score of 6 or 6.5 for admission into their undergraduate programs, while graduate programs may require a score of 7 or higher. The higher the score, the better the chances of getting admission into a good program.

The IELTS band score is categorised into different levels, each indicating a different English proficiency level. A score of 9 indicates an expert level, 8 is an excellent level, 7 is proficient, 6 is competent, and 5 is modest. A higher band score not only improves one's chances of being admitted into a program but also increases the opportunities for scholarships and financial aid.

Durham College:

Located in Oshawa, Ontario, Durham College offers a variety of certificate, diploma, and degree programs in areas such as business, media, technology, health, and engineering. Some popular programs include business administration, computer programming, nursing, and culinary management.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 14,000 to CAD 22,000 per year, depending on the program.

Niagara College:

Niagara College is a public college located in the Niagara Region of Ontario. It offers over 130 certificate, diploma, and degree programs in business, hospitality, tourism, technology, and health sciences. Some popular programs include business administration, computer engineering technology, culinary management, and nursing.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 14,000 to CAD 17,000 per year, depending on the program.

Oxford College:

Oxford College is a private career college with campuses in Toronto and Scarborough, Ontario. It offers certificate and diploma programs in healthcare, business, law enforcement, and technology. Some popular programs include medical office assistant, paralegal, and network engineering.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 10,000 to CAD 25,000, depending on the program.

College of New Caledonia:

College of New Caledonia is a public college in Prince George, British Columbia. It offers a range of certificate, diploma, and degree programs in areas such as business, health sciences, trades, and technology. Some popular programs include business administration, practical nursing, and welding.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 14,000 to CAD 16,000 per year, depending on the program.

Camosun College:

Camosun College is a public college located in Victoria, British Columbia. It offers certificate, diploma, and degree programs in business, health, trades, and technology. Some popular programs include business administration, dental hygiene, and computer science.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 14,000 to CAD 16,000 per year, depending on the program.

HEC Montreal:

HEC Montreal is a French-language business school located in Montreal, Quebec. It offers a range of undergraduate and graduate programs in areas such as management, finance, marketing, and accounting. Some popular programs include Bachelor of Business Administration (BBA), Master of Science (MSc), and MBA.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 30,000 to CAD 45,000 per year, depending on the program.

Vancouver Island University:

Vancouver Island University is a public university located in Nanaimo, British Columbia. It offers undergraduate and graduate business, arts, health sciences, and education programs. Some of the popular programs include Bachelor of Science (BSc) in Nursing, Bachelor of Education (BEd), and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Psychology. The estimated tuition fees for international students range from CAD 15,000 to CAD 20,000 per year, depending on the program.

University of Lethbridge:

The University of Lethbridge is a public research university in Lethbridge, Alberta. It offers undergraduate and graduate arts, science, management, education, and health sciences programs. Some of the popular programs include a Bachelor of Science (BSc) in Computer Science, a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Psychology, and a Master of Business Administration (MBA). The estimated tuition fees for international students range from $18,444 to $21,834 per year for undergraduate programs and $5,367 to $12,687 per year for graduate programs, depending on the program of study. The university also offers various scholarships and bursaries to international students based on academic excellence and financial need.

List out the academic requirements to apply for MS in Canada

The academic requirements to apply for MS in Canada can vary depending on the university and program you are applying to. However, here are some general academic requirements that most universities in Canada may ask for:

    • A completed undergraduate degree: Most universities in Canada require applicants to have a completed four-year undergraduate degree or its equivalent from a recognised institution.
    • Minimum Grade Point Average (GPA): Universities in Canada usually require a minimum GPA of 3.0 on a 4.0 scale or its equivalent. However, some universities may require a higher GPA, depending on the program and the level of competition.
    • Language proficiency: As English and French are the official languages of Canada, international students whose first language is not English may be required to submit proof of English proficiency. Most universities accept results from language tests such as TOEFL, IELTS, and PTE Academic.
    • Standardised tests: Depending on the program and the university, some programs may require standardised tests, such as GRE or GMAT.
    • Letters of recommendation: Most universities require two to three letters of recommendation from professors, employers, or supervisors who know the applicant's academic or professional work.
    • Statement of Purpose: Most universities require applicants to submit a statement outlining their academic and professional background, reasons for pursuing the program, and future career goals.
